Tip 4: Go Sheer
The transparent look was all over the Spring runways at BCBG Max Azria
Delicate fabrics like chiffon were mixed with muted colors and pastels to create a fairy-tale inspired look that’s ultra feminine and so much fun to wear. It’s really whimsical, ethereal, and not to mention sexy.
Note that the transparency trend isn’t about showing your underwear off, but about covering up using a few slightly see-through pieces layered over solids. It’s sexy in a subtle way, as opposed to when someone’s outfit screams “my clothes are see through!” Here’s how to wear it right:
Sheer Dresses are the epitome of what this trend is about. They’re so girly and romantic, especially in muted colors or pastels. There are tons of dresses out there that have sheer elements to them, like a layers of chiffon and even MOHAIR, but a DIY way to wear this look is to buy a sheer slip and layer it over another dress. You can find sheer slips for next to nothing at vintage or second hand stores, so they’re a great option if you’re on a budget.Sheer Tops and Tunics are an easy and affordable way to try this trend out and incorporate a little transparency into your look. Sheer fabrics look great as blouses and dressy tops, or as mini dresses worn over leggings or shorts. If you’re going to wear a sheer top, however, make sure you wear a non-sheer tank under it, and check your outfit in bright light to avoid your bra showing through!

Tip #6: Color Block!
Colorblocked silk dresses and tops can work for summer with sandals and for winter if you layer a thin black knit underneath. Find them at.....Macy's..Color Block Dress Made by INC International Concepts $59.97

They Add Edge: "Patterned tights add instant edge to a LBD (little black dress) and are perfect for extra coverage in a mini," Adams says. "As far as footwear goes, patterned tights with peep-toe booties are perfect for ladies who want to be on top of the latest trends. But, a classic platform pump is always a safe bet."
Bob and Weave styles: "Open weave styles in vertical patterns elongate the leg and are popular this fall," says Spanx's Adams. "Also, classic and vintage-inspired patterns like hounds tooth, diamond, Swiss dot and back seams have been top picks for Spanx fans. They are chic, sexy and still totally appropriate for the office."Shine On: "Be confident in your choice (of tights) and use them as your statement piece," says Donna Karan's Cathy Volker. "Metallics and lace are a great wardrobe addition. Adding a few pairs this season will help update your holiday wardrobe without breaking the bank on party dresses."
